Key Factors Affecting Battery Runtime
To estimate how long a 12V battery can power lighting via an inverter, consider these variables:
- Battery Capacity (Ah): A 100Ah battery stores 12V x 100Ah = 1,200Wh of energy.
- Inverter Efficiency: Most inverters lose 10-15% energy during DC-to-AC conversion.
- Lighting Wattage: LED bulbs (5-15W) last longer than incandescent bulbs (40-100W).
Step-by-Step Runtime Calculation
Let's calculate with a 100Ah battery powering 50W LED lights:
- Total energy: 12V x 100Ah = 1,200Wh
- Adjusted for 85% inverter efficiency: 1,200Wh x 0.85 = 1,020Wh
- Runtime = 1,020Wh ÷ 50W = 20.4 hours

5 Tips to Extend Battery Life
- Use energy-efficient LEDs instead of halogen bulbs
- Disconnect unused devices to prevent phantom loads
- Keep batteries at 50-80% charge for longevity
FAQs: 12V Battery Lighting Systems
Q: Can I recharge the battery while using the inverter? A: Yes, with solar panels or a alternator charger, but it may slow charging speed.
Q: What's the best inverter type for lighting? A: Pure sine wave inverters (≥90% efficiency) work best for sensitive electronics.
